Bis(p-tolyl)phosphine Oxide, identified by its CAS number 2409-61-2, is a versatile organophosphorus compound that plays a significant role in various synthetic pathways, most notably in palladium-catalyzed cross-coupling reactions like the Suzuki coupling. Typically supplied as a white to off-white powder, this compound is sought after by researchers and manufacturers alike for its contribution to building complex molecular architectures.
